Output dd94bebcd43f0b1e517f5128ad47e16f75693d76fb5c230351151220ec20645d:19
- value
- 503615
- script pubkey
- OP_0 OP_PUSHBYTES_20 389b12a031ded53214a9621f502bfd6764fe552a
- address
- bc1q8zd39gp3mm2ny99fvg04q2lavaj0u4f2nfqvhr
- transaction
- dd94bebcd43f0b1e517f5128ad47e16f75693d76fb5c230351151220ec20645d
- confirmations
- 142148
- spent
- true